SLB CEO says Q2 EBITDA to be flat sequentially, slightly down from prior guidance
SLB LIMITED/NV
- Q2 revenue expected flattish sequentially but unfavorable geographic mix impacting margins.
- Saudi Arabia activity declined ahead of expectations with additional rig demobilizations and Jafurah unconventional pause.
- Lower short-cycle activity in Latin America offset by growth in Middle East and North Africa.
- Company-wide EBITDA now expected flat sequentially, slightly down from expectations shared on Q1 earnings call.
- Commitment to returning minimum $4 billion to shareholders in 2025 unchanged.
